Nevertheless, back in 1997, there was an epic 3 hour TV movie made for NBC in two parts and it’s now streaming for free on YouTube via Popcornflix. Covering more of the story and staying true to the fantastical, this version stars Armand Assante as Odysseus.

He’s joined by an impressive cast, including Gerald Chaplin as Eurycleia, Christopher Lee as Tiresias, Eric Roberts as Eurymachus and Vanessa Williams as Calypso. What’s particularly fun and 90s about this one is that the monster effects were done by Jim Henson’s Creature Shop. The Odyssey went on to win an Emmy for Outstanding Directing for a Miniseries or Special.

The Rotten Tomatoes consensus for 1997’s The Odyssey reads: “The Odyssey delivers an exhilarating, visually spectacular retelling of Homer’s epic, buoyed by a committed international cast and a brisk sense of adventure.” Three years later, NBC adapted Jason and the Argonauts and that too is available to watch for free on YouTube.
